Unlock Your Path to Approval: Discover the Essential Bad Credit Car Loan Qualifications

When it comes to getting approved for a loan, lenders have different requirements, but let's dive into some of the most common qualifications you may encounter. First and foremost, there's the loan-to-value (LTV) consideration. To boost your chances of approval, aim for an LTV that's less than 120%. What does this mean? Well, LTV represents the amount you're financing compared to the value of the vehicle. If your LTV is higher, it typically suggests either no down payment or negative equity on a trade-in. So, if you can, putting down a down payment can work wonders for your approval prospects.

Repossessions

Keeping a clean slate when it comes to previous repossessions is essential. It's important to avoid letting a vehicle go into repossession status as it can hinder your chances of getting pre-approved for a car loan.

Income

Your income plays a crucial role in ensuring you can comfortably afford those high car payments. Yes, brace yourself for high payments, especially with bad credit loans, as they often come with interest rates between 14-18% or even higher, depending on where you reside. So, remember to factor in this higher interest rate when considering your monthly budget.

The road to loan approval might have its twists and turns, but with these qualifications in mind, you'll be better prepared to tackle the journey.

5 Essential Tips to Steer Clear of Bad Credit Auto Loans: Your Path to Financial Freedom

When it comes to bad credit auto loans, it's crucial to carefully consider your options before making a purchase. These loans are often a last resort for individuals without any other alternatives to buy a car. Regrettably, bad credit loans come with certain drawbacks. They come with high interest rates, require larger down payments, and limit your vehicle choices to what the dealer decides rather than your preferences. It's important to compare what your loan would look like with good credit versus what you currently qualify for. When you examine the monthly payments or the overall cost over time, you might be surprised and reconsider your decision to buy a car. Instead of immediately opting for a bad credit auto loan, it is advisable to focus on improving your credit first. Bad credit loans can have long-term consequences and worsen your financial and credit situation. Most people with bad credit already face financial difficulties, so adding another expense to your credit could exacerbate the problem. I suggest researching credit repair and raising your credit scores before purchasing a car. This can help you avoid paying exorbitant interest rates and ensure a more stable financial future. Ultimately, it's better to drive into the future with a solid credit foundation and financial peace of mind.


The Ultimate Guide to Navigating a Bad Credit Loan: Key Factors to Consider for a Successful Approval

When it comes to getting approved for a bad credit loan, it's important to be aware of your limited options. Many people in this situation often follow the dealership's instructions without questioning important details like the purchase price and interest rate. Excitement about the approval can sometimes lead to making emotional decisions. However, it's crucial to take a step back and ask questions that will help determine how this new auto loan will impact your future. Are you already maxed out on your budget? If so, it's likely that your next car payment will go up rather than down. Considering inflation and the rising cost of vehicles, it's highly improbable that your next auto loan will be cheaper than your current one. Therefore, it's essential to consider your budget before making any emotional decisions regarding your next purchase.

A great approach

A great approach is to go directly to the lender and get pre-approved for a vehicle before setting foot in a dealership. Capital One, for example, often offers pre-approvals to individuals with bad credit. By having a pre-approval in hand, you gain better control over the purchase process. While getting a pre-approval may be challenging, it's worth investing time in researching loan options before spontaneously showing up at a dealership.
